using System.Collections.Generic; using System.Net.Security; using System.ServiceModel.Channels; using System.ServiceModel.Description; using System.Text; using System.Xml; using System.ServiceModel.Configuration; namespace System.ServiceModel { public class BasicHttpBinding : Binding, IBindingRuntimePreferences { bool allow_cookies, bypass_proxy_on_local; HostNameComparisonMode host_name_comparison_mode = HostNameComparisonMode.StrongWildcard; long max_buffer_pool_size = 0x80000; int max_buffer_size = 0x10000; long max_recv_message_size = 0x10000; WSMessageEncoding message_encoding = WSMessageEncoding.Text; Uri proxy_address; XmlDictionaryReaderQuotas reader_quotas = new XmlDictionaryReaderQuotas (); EnvelopeVersion env_version = EnvelopeVersion.Soap11; Encoding text_encoding = new UTF8Encoding (); TransferMode transfer_mode = TransferMode.Buffered; bool use_default_web_proxy = true; BasicHttpSecurity security; public BasicHttpBinding () : this (BasicHttpSecurityMode.None) { } #if !NET_2_1 public BasicHttpBinding (string configurationName) : this () { BindingsSection bindingsSection = ConfigUtil.BindingsSection; BasicHttpBindingElement el = bindingsSection.BasicHttpBinding.Bindings [configurationName]; el.ApplyConfiguration (this); } #endif public BasicHttpBinding ( BasicHttpSecurityMode securityMode) { security = new BasicHttpSecurity (securityMode); } public bool AllowCookies { get { return allow_cookies; } set { allow_cookies = value; } } public bool BypassProxyOnLocal { get { return bypass_proxy_on_local; } set { bypass_proxy_on_local = value; } } public HostNameComparisonMode HostNameComparisonMode { get { return host_name_comparison_mode; } set { host_name_comparison_mode = value; } } public long MaxBufferPoolSize { get { return max_buffer_pool_size; } set { if (value <= 0) throw new ArgumentOutOfRangeException (); max_buffer_pool_size = value; } } public int MaxBufferSize { get { return max_buffer_size; } set { if (value <= 0) throw new ArgumentOutOfRangeException (); max_buffer_size = value; } } public long MaxReceivedMessageSize { get { return max_recv_message_size; } set { if (value <= 0) throw new ArgumentOutOfRangeException (); max_recv_message_size = value; } } public WSMessageEncoding MessageEncoding { get { return message_encoding; } set { message_encoding = value; } } public Uri ProxyAddress { get { return proxy_address; } set { proxy_address = value; } } public XmlDictionaryReaderQuotas ReaderQuotas { get { return reader_quotas; } set { reader_quotas = value; } } public override string Scheme { get { switch (Security.Mode) { case BasicHttpSecurityMode.Transport: case BasicHttpSecurityMode.TransportWithMessageCredential: return Uri.UriSchemeHttps; default: return Uri.UriSchemeHttp; } } } public BasicHttpSecurity Security { get { return security; } } public EnvelopeVersion EnvelopeVersion { get { return env_version; } } public Encoding TextEncoding { get { return text_encoding; } set { text_encoding = value; } } public TransferMode TransferMode { get { return transfer_mode; } set { transfer_mode = value; } } public bool UseDefaultWebProxy { get { return use_default_web_proxy; } set { use_default_web_proxy = value; } } public override BindingElementCollection CreateBindingElements () { switch (Security.Mode) { #if !NET_2_1 case BasicHttpSecurityMode.Message: case BasicHttpSecurityMode.TransportWithMessageCredential: if (Security.Message.ClientCredentialType != BasicHttpMessageCredentialType.Certificate) throw new InvalidOperationException ("When Message security is enabled in a BasicHttpBinding, the message security credential type must be BasicHttpMessageCredentialType.Certificate."); return new BindingElementCollection (new BindingElement [] { // FIXME: pass proper security token parameters. new AsymmetricSecurityBindingElement (), BuildMessageEncodingBindingElement (), GetTransport ()}); #endif default: return new BindingElementCollection (new BindingElement [] { BuildMessageEncodingBindingElement (), GetTransport ()}); } } MessageEncodingBindingElement BuildMessageEncodingBindingElement () { if (MessageEncoding == WSMessageEncoding.Text) { TextMessageEncodingBindingElement tm = new TextMessageEncodingBindingElement ( MessageVersion.CreateVersion (EnvelopeVersion, AddressingVersion.None), TextEncoding); #if !NET_2_1 ReaderQuotas.CopyTo (tm.ReaderQuotas); #endif return tm; } else #if NET_2_1 throw new SystemException ("INTERNAL ERROR: should not happen"); #else return new MtomMessageEncodingBindingElement ( MessageVersion.CreateVersion (EnvelopeVersion, AddressingVersion.None), TextEncoding); #endif } TransportBindingElement GetTransport () { HttpTransportBindingElement transportBindingElement; switch (Security.Mode) { case BasicHttpSecurityMode.Transport: case BasicHttpSecurityMode.TransportWithMessageCredential: transportBindingElement = new HttpsTransportBindingElement (); break; default: transportBindingElement = new HttpTransportBindingElement (); break; } transportBindingElement.AllowCookies = AllowCookies; transportBindingElement.BypassProxyOnLocal = BypassProxyOnLocal; transportBindingElement.HostNameComparisonMode = HostNameComparisonMode; transportBindingElement.MaxBufferPoolSize = MaxBufferPoolSize; transportBindingElement.MaxBufferSize = MaxBufferSize; transportBindingElement.MaxReceivedMessageSize = MaxReceivedMessageSize; transportBindingElement.ProxyAddress = ProxyAddress; transportBindingElement.UseDefaultWebProxy = UseDefaultWebProxy; transportBindingElement.TransferMode = TransferMode; return transportBindingElement; } // explicit interface implementations bool IBindingRuntimePreferences.ReceiveSynchronously { get { return false; } } } }
